briandors Posted October 14, 2003 Report Posted October 14, 2003 Friend's 95 Monte Carlo 3.4 needs a new water pump. Any tips or a how-to would be greatly appreciated. Brian Quote
brian89gp Posted October 14, 2003 Report Posted October 14, 2003 loosen the 4 bolts on the pulley before you take the belt off, and if you don't drain the coolant have some extra ready. Other then that it is a 10 minute job. Quote
99RegalGS Posted October 14, 2003 Report Posted October 14, 2003 To be extra safe from leaks put some RTV blue or black sealnt on both sides of the gasket and around the bolt holes. It ia a pretty straight forward job though. Quote
